4. Brothers Sebastian (18), Remington (16), and Emerson (14) have been writing songs before
they could ride bicycles. Discovering their passion for music at an early age, the trio has
dedicated themselves to writing meaningful songs about life as they see it. Whether it’s songs
about a first crush, losing a close friend, disappointment, or the highs and lows of everyday
teen life, Kropp Circle writes about the experiences of their generation.
“Even though we are young, we have a voice and are lucky we can express the way we feel through
our music,” says Sebastian. “The words, music, and the way it is arranged are important to us—
people matter and words count.”

Kropp Circle constantly works on their craft and most nights you’ll find them in their studio
working on songs for their upcoming debut CD. The brothers are schooled in pop music and
count among their varied influences Oasis, Coldplay, Radiohead, Sigur Rós, GooGoo Dolls, and
Matchbox Twenty. It’s this background in music that brings purpose and seriousness to the
songs of this unique, young musical trio.
